All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/il/ilfi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Joy Fisher sdgenweb@yahoo.com January 7, 2008, 2:19 am Officers and Enlisted Men... 1920 CLEMENTS, PAUL MATTHEW, apprentice seaman, United States Navy. Unlisted: Chicago, Ill., June 5, 1917. Died: Naval hospital, Newport, R. I., August 2, 1917. Cause: Foreign body in trachea. Next of kin: Mother, Antonia Clements, 1404 North Twelfth Avenue, Chicago, Ill.
